APG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

210 of the 6,237 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in APi Group (APG)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$3.31B — up 43% from $2.31B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 28 funds closed out of APG and 23 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 68 trimmed existing stakes and 90 added.

The largest buyer was Teacher Retirement System of Texas, adding an estimated $13.3M. The largest seller was Robeco Schweiz, cutting an estimated $22.6M.
